0:58 Parable of the sower by Octavia Butler Goodreads Rating: 4.21 ⭐ out of 5 ⭐ Genres: Fiction, Science Fiction, Dystopia, Fantasy, Classics, Post-Apocalyptic, Speculative Fiction Page Count: 345 pages 3:41 Killers of the Flower Moon: The Osage Murders and the Birth of the FBI by David Grann Goodreads Rating: 4.15 ⭐ out of 5 ⭐ Genres: Nonfiction, History, True Crime, Crime, Audiobook, Mystery, Historical Page Count: 416 pages 7:09 If You Could See the Sun by Ann Liang Goodreads Rating: 4.03 ⭐ out of 5 ⭐ Genres: Fantasy, Romance, Young Adult, Contemporary, Magical Realism, Fiction, Asian Literature Page Count: 345 pages 10:28 The Downstairs Girl by Stacey Lee Goodreads Rating: 3.97 ⭐ out of 5 ⭐ Genres: Historical Fiction, Young Adult, Fiction, Audiobook, Romance, Asian Literature Page Count: 374 pages 12:51 Witch Hat Atelier, Vol. 1 by Kamome Shirahama Goodreads Rating: 4.41 ⭐ out of 5 ⭐ Genres: Manga, Fantasy, Graphic Novels, Comics, Young Adult, Fiction, Magic Page Count: 204 pages 16:42 Scythe by Neal Shusterman Goodreads Rating: 4.33 ⭐ out of 5 ⭐ Genres: Fantasy, Young Adult, Dystopia, Science Fiction, Fiction Page Count: 435 pages 20:17 The Red Palace by June Hur Goodreads Rating: 4.14 ⭐ out of 5 ⭐ Genres: Historical Fiction, Mystery, Young Adult, Historical Romance, Fiction, Fantasy Page Count: 336 pages
